Von Willebrand's disease is an inherited bleeding disorder that prevents blood from clotting properly. In this disease, a protein in the body's blood system (von Willebrand factor) is missing or does not work well, and the blood cells (platelets) cannot stick together normally to form clots at the site of bleeding...

Vulnerable adults are those who are not able to defend themselves, protect themselves, or get help for themselves when injured or emotionally abused. A person may be vulnerable because of a physical condition or illness, such as weakness in an older adult or physical disability, or a mental or emotional condition.
